About Blackbird Ceramics - Studio Pottery by Richard Prentice

Richard Prentice is a studio potter and ceramic artists based in Pembrokeshire with a small gallery situated in the pretty harbour village of Saundersfoot, footsteps away from some of south Pembrokeshire’s best beaches. Richard’s work is influenced by the stunning coastline setting of his studio and the industrial mining history of South Pembrokeshire.

Often taking classical forms and making them contemporary and relevant to his environment, the main body of Richard’s work are Sea Globes, Sea Urns and Colliery Pots. His work has been collected by clients around the world.
